Class: Wakame::Command::AgentStatus
- Inherits:
-
Object
- Object
- Wakame::Command::AgentStatus
show all
- Includes:
- Wakame::Command
- Defined in:
- lib/wakame/command/agent_status.rb
Instance Method Summary
collapse
included, #options=, #params
Instance Method Details
#run(rule) ⇒ Object
7
8
9
10
11
12
13
14
15
16
17
|
# File 'lib/wakame/command/agent_status.rb', line 7
def run(rule)
EM.barrier {
registered_agents = rule.agent_monitor.registered_agents[@options["agent_id"]]
service_cluster = rule.service_cluster
res ={
:agent_status =>registered_agents.dump_status,
:service_cluster =>service_cluster.dump_status
}
res
}
end
|